“corde vocali” is born from the encounter between giada forte and pauline guerrier, to explore the human identity in its genesis. inspired by anatomy charts of vocal cords sketched by pauline guerrier, the artist and giada forte depict the phonation organ in their respective art forms. the voice’s evocative and symbolic power is part of our identity. it pictures our soul and conveys our emotions. this collaboration shakes our own personal view and perception of a person beyond the physical and obvious appearance. giada and pauline take a special glimpse at life. through their artistic and symbolic aspirations they raise the question of identity in its more intimate forms: body and voice.

pauline guerrier’s meditative approach constantly questions the subjects of identity, body and spirit. her creations focus on the human relationship between time, space and origin. “make the invisible visible”. the corde vocali frescoes, entirely hand–made, attest to the quasi scientific study of the physiology of the larynx. the different pieces reveal a three–dimensional approach magnifying resonant cavities, the ripples and shapes of this otherwise highly complex part of the body. pauline carefully selects, uses and interprets fabrics from forte_forte archive. raw and rigid, as well as silky and delicate materials illustrate the tissues that define our anatomy. she has a sharp yet tender look, which echoes the vocal vibrations revealing the mysteries. her work is presented in the form of panels between decorations and abstract landscape paintings with curves and lines which also represent the voice, sound, nature and life. the 14 canvases represent 3 scenes: birth, voice change, acceptance. first, 2 meter high canvases are followed by several panels to create frescoes up to 5 meters wide for some and 4 meters high for others. each strip of fabric is carefully torn, then meticulously pleated and assembled in layers to become so many vanishing points that run through the monumental friezes, as subtle drawings of the roughness and beauty of the vocal cords.

giada forte creates a collection mixing feminine and masculine stereotypes, extending the body to the limits of both identities as an intimate, sensual sphere. the corde vocali capsule consists of 14 pieces that enhance and repurpose iconic men’s and women’s wardrobe. the garments are deconstructed and reassembled: the inside comes out, the invisible is revealed, hints of imperfect artisanal finishes reflect humanity. jacquards are woven in linen, rustically spun cotton canvas, silk organza, crisp poplin... many different, authentic natural materials. in transparency, fabric fibres are layered on the skin, living life to shapes while matter comes alive. the men’s trench coat is like an allegorical piece made of linen and silk, with unstructured shoulders, dressed in transparent organza sleeves.

the use of mixed fabrics escapes all classifications, delicacy is opposed to robustness. colors such as midnight blue and black contrast with feminine notes such as cipria and ecru. iridescent shimmers can be seen when prints and embroidered arabesques tell the movement of pauline’s works. a visual symphony that exalts a form of freedom and suggests the respect and elegance for neither a male nor female gender.

within a space shaped by artworks and clothes, erwin aros combines voice with visual experience; it is an invitation to explore the personal identity. the performance – planned as an initiatory journey, will consist of 3 parts taken from 3 works: “humana fragilità” by monteverdi, “tis nature’s voice” by henry purcell and “la barcheta” by reynaldo hahn. accompanied by a piano, erwin aros will arrange the 3 arias as one, offering contemplative music where the voice (countertenor) is high pitched in the treble, as if it were suspended. the sound experience is a mise en abyme that links to each element of the exhibition. thus, the recital goes deep by using classic codes to explore contemporary subjects.
